The root cause is caused by the command timeout issued from mt7925 driver. [Fix] Cherry-pick the following two patches from linux-next: 1b97fc8443ae wifi: mt76: mt7925: fix the unfinished command of regd_notifier before suspend 8f6571ad470f wifi: mt76: mt7925: add handler to hif suspend/resume event Also, cherry-pick the following commits from linux-firmware: 47c8a6053c64 linux-firmware: update firmware for MT7925 WiFi device 62ee1c4b2d35 linux-firmware: update firmware for MT7925 WiFi device [Test Plan] 1. Install Ubuntu image and boot into the OS 2. Run the suspend test by $ fwts s3 --s3-device-check --s3-device-check-delay=60 --s3-multiple=1 --s3-sleep-delay=60, and see if the error occurred. [Where problems could occur] Due to the new FW, there might be a unexpected behavior of the MT7925 hardware.
